Weather snapshot
The weather in Pune features a tropical climate with warm summers, refreshing monsoons, and pleasant winters. Here's what to expect throughout the year:
December – February: Winter brings cooler days and gentle evenings, making these the best times to explore Pune. Light cotton clothes work perfectly during the day, with a thin jacket for after dark.
March – May: Summer arrives with warm, dry weather that's ideal for sightseeing and outdoor activities. Stay hydrated and plan visits to indoor attractions during the hottest afternoon hours.
June – September: Pune's monsoon season delivers warm temperatures with regular rainfall that transforms the city into a lush green landscape. You'll need light, quick-dry clothing and a reliable umbrella for exploring indoor attractions and covered markets during this refreshing time.
October – November: Post-monsoon weather brings relief with sunny skies and moderate temperatures perfect for exploring outdoor attractions, sightseeing around the city, and enjoying nature walks through Pune's green spaces.
Sightseeing and travel inspiration
Pune combines centuries-old temples and forts with modern universities and technology companies. The city attracts students from across the country while maintaining strong cultural traditions through classical music, theatre, and festivals. Whether you're booking flights to Pune for education, business, or exploration, you'll find a blend of historical sites and contemporary life.
Things to do in Pune: Explore the sprawling Aga Khan Palace gardens about 8 kilometres northeast of the centre, where you can walk through manicured lawns and spot peacocks roaming freely. Head to Saras Baug, roughly 4 kilometres south, for morning jogs around the lake or picnics under the trees. For mountain views and fresh air, drive 15 kilometres southwest to Sinhagad Fort, where hiking trails lead to the ancient ruins perched on a hilltop.
Cultural experiences: Attend classical music performances at Balgandharva Rang Mandir theatre, about 3 kilometres southwest of central Pune, or admire traditional Marathi theatre productions at Tilak Smarak Mandir around 2 kilometres north. Sample authentic Maharashtrian thali at local eateries in the historic Kasba Peth area, roughly 1 kilometre southeast, and browse handcrafted items at the bustling markets nearby.
Seasonal highlights: Experience the colourful Ganesh Chaturthi celebrations in August and September with elaborate processions and street festivities throughout the city. The cooler months from November to February offer pleasant weather for exploring Shaniwar Wada fort and nearby hill stations. This period marks the best time to visit Pune when temperatures remain comfortable for outdoor activities and the post-monsoon landscape appears fresh and green.
